How do you change the tax #2 ??? tax #1 is 5% and tax #2 is 7,5% but i want to change tax #2 for 8,5%, how should i proceed??

i have cash reg. gold 2100 , and i programed the cash reg for (7.5 % to 8.5% ), by changing the 1508030 tax shift 2 to 1509030 tax shift 2 while the key is on program position.

the steps from beginning :
first: put the key on prog position.
2nd: enter 1505000 then press tax shift 1 ( 5%)
3rd : enter 1509030 then press tax shift 2 ( 8.5 %)
4th : enter 037000000 dep 1 ( tax able )
5th : enter 037000000 dep 2 ( tax able )
6th: enter 037000000 dep 3 ( tax able )
7th: press # / no sale .

put the key to reg position and try it . good luck and happy new year.

p.s. for no tax dept dont enter any thing .

Programming sales tax

You're right, the manual is terrible but I think I got it worked out...
Turn to PGM mode.
  • Press 3 then subtotal button.
  • Press subtotal button again.
  • Then endter tax rate (if even enter two digits 05 for 5%, if more enter 4 digits like 5.75 *5+.+7+5 for 5.75%) and press ca/amt tend button
  • Press 0 and press ca/amt tend button
  • Press 0125 and press ca/amt tend button *this is for rounding/tax table code not positive on this one but looks like the right entry for "add on" tax
  • Press sub total button
This should change your tax

Change the tax rate on calculator on MS-8TV

SETTING YOUR TAX RATE
you hold your set % button down for three seconds until set shows again, then hit tax rate button it shows your tax rate, change your tax rate then hit set your tax rate should be set.



cliff notes:
hold set% button
hit tax+ button
change the desired % 
hit set done

Casio tk1300

I'm in Australia and only going on the program manual for your area, it states that canadian tax is tax on tax? if this is true then you probably entered a code for add on or add in tax and thereby changed it all.

you need the following

tax table address
1 125
2 225
3 325
4 425

rounding off codes
rounding off to 2 decimal places is 50
rounding up to 2 decimal places is 90
cut off to 2 decimal places is 00

tax system code
tax table with out tax rate 01
tax table with tax rate and add on rate 02
add in tax rate 03
Canadian tax-on-tax rate 04

starting point
to get the starting point you multiply by 100 and subtract 1
eg 50 cents = 0.50 X 100 - 1 = 50 - 1 = 49
eg $4 = 4.00 x 100 -1 = 399

to program the tables go through these steps

go to program 3
tax table address eg 125
subtotal
tax rate
ca/amt tend
starting point eg 0.50 = 49
ca/amt tend
rounding eg 50
tax system eg 04
ca/amt tend
ca/amt tend

here you have 2 choices,

press ca/amt tend to go to the next tax table ie 225 and start over by entering the tax rate and go through the procedure again

or

press subtotal to finalise the tax table you are on
